Transaction 900813761ae374230d41f45a0f196bbc48fd829849b829126065c31a1552bf65
1 Input
1 Output
-
900813761ae374230d41f45a0f196bbc48fd829849b829126065c31a1552bf65:0
- value
- 143204
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aeaf9319afe3b1b1c4124cef76d5894b91e8c1e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GveuWwsGW7r3eEmSnLhekGhT6NnYgbxoz